we already know how to Use Infrared remote controls.

But it has some disadvantages

  1. We have to make Receiver
  2. Recever & remote should be in same line
  3. Lots of configrations required

What id we could use a Bluetooth enabled Mobile phone?

Advantages

  1. No need to make anything
  2. Larger distance & no need to pointing mobile in direction PC

I am looking at How to turn a Bluetooth enabled mobile phone into full fledged PC remote.

Please guide on setting this up on Windows XP and Linux(if possible)

dunno bout LG or nokia but in SE it is very straight forward.

I have installed toshiba bluetooth stack on my lappy which supports BT remote control. I just add my lappy as a paired devide with my K750i, start remote control and voila! :P

SE has even provided some software of its own where you can customise the keys on the phone to perform two-three key combos. you can then transfer the file thru BT to your phone, even make a skin for the remote control :D
